- 2 dictionary resultsMain Entry: median nerve
Function: noun
: a nerve that arises by two roots from the brachial plexus and passes down the middle of the front of the arm

median nerve n.
A nerve that is formed by the union of the medial and lateral roots from the medial and lateral cords of the brachial plexus and supplies the muscular branches in the anterior region of the forearm and the muscular and cutaneous branches in the hand.
